// tries to parse all document properties, getting authorization if we can, but otherwise // gracefully falls back to just getting public properties private void collectDocumentProperties(string file) { byte[] fileLicense; SafeInformationProtectionKeyHandle keyHandle; fileLicense = SafeFileApiNativeMethods.IpcfGetSerializedLicenseFromFile(file); keyHandle = null; try { keyHandle = SafeNativeMethods.IpcGetKey(fileLicense, false, false, true, this); } catch { } propertyParser = new RmsPropertyParser(fileLicense, keyHandle); }
